A Brief Overview
Evaluates and monitors the patient's hemodynamic and clinical status informing provider and team members of changes for Hybrid OR. Provides cardiovascular technical support with room set up/turnover, transportation, and inventory needs of the region for EP Lab and Hybrid OR. Supports emergency call needs for Hybrid OR.
Education Qualifications

  • High School Diploma / GED Required
  • Successfully completed a certified CNA/EMT program Required

Experience Qualifications
  • 1 year Cardiovascular related experience. Preferred

Licenses and Certifications
  • Active certification to practice in Kansas as either an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) OR Certified Nurse Assistant (CNA) is required.
  • Basic Life Support - BLS Required within 90 days of hire.
  • Advanced Cardiac Life Support - ACLS Required within 90 days of hire.
